mac80211: Update to backports-5.10.42
The removed patches were integrated upstream.
The brcmf_driver_work workqueue was removed in brcmfmac with kernel
5.10.42, the asynchronous call was covered to a synchronous call. There
is no need to wait any more.
This part was removed manually from this patch:
brcm/860-brcmfmac-register-wiphy-s-during-module_init.patch

In certain scenarios a normal MSDU can be received as an A-MSDU when
|
||||
the A-MSDU present bit of a QoS header gets flipped during reception.
|
||||
Since this bit is unauthenticated, the hardware crypto engine can pass
|
||||
the frame to the driver without any error indication.
|
||||
|
||||
This could result in processing unintended subframes collected in the
|
||||
A-MSDU list. Hence, validate A-MSDU list by checking if the first frame
|
||||
has a valid subframe header.
|
||||
|
||||
Comparing the non-aggregated MSDU and an A-MSDU, the fields of the first
|
||||
subframe DA matches the LLC/SNAP header fields of a normal MSDU.
|
||||
In order to avoid processing such frames, add a validation to
|
||||
filter such A-MSDU frames where the first subframe header DA matches
|
||||
with the LLC/SNAP header pattern.
